Welcome Burger King’s NY Pizza Burger. [pic] What in the hell were these people thinking about when coming up with this concept? This pizza-burger hybrid consists of four Whopper patties, bacon, pepperoni, cheese, and marinara sauce. These six slices of a heart attack contain over 2500 calories, 144g of fat (59g of which are artery clogging saturated fat), and 3780mg of salt (double what we need). Studies show that eating 1.6 ounces of dark chocolate daily can be good for you! Dark chocolate contains a higher percentage of cocoa…cocoa is rich in antioxidants (believed to help the body’s cells resist damage caused by free radicals that are formed by normal bodily processes such as breathing and from environmental contaminants like cigarette smoke). It’s fish time again! I’m preparing tilapia (again) but this time with black (or forbidden rice) and steamed veggies. What really is black rice? It is rice that is black…or purple to be exact. Black rice, Chinese in origin, is “forbidden” because only the Emperor could eat it and no one else. [Source] [Source] Former President Bill Clinton’s heart has been through a lot: a quadruple coronary artery bypass surgery in 2004, complications from that surgery, and having two stents placed into his coronary artery earlier this year. It should come as no surprise that Clinton adopted a healthier lifestyle in an effort to stay away from the operation table. TRX is TRX Suspension Training; I’ve been hearing a lot about it recently and it seems like the hottness right now. According to the official website: Born in the U.S. Navy SEALS and developed by Fitness Anywhere®, Suspension Training® is a revolutionary method of leveraged bodyweight exercise. TRX training consists of hundreds of different exercises that promise to build strength and flexibility without injuring yourself.
